Output 34ab07c59ba52cabfaf19c281bad4309d2b12bb0aacc7c7e252fa9a5bf547d0a:0

value
764449
script pubkey
OP_0 OP_PUSHBYTES_20 5183e7779d26430a7173925c39000ee94ee2c08a
address
bc1q2xp7wauayeps5utnjfwrjqqwa98w9sy23alvp0
transaction
34ab07c59ba52cabfaf19c281bad4309d2b12bb0aacc7c7e252fa9a5bf547d0a